Impact of Cold Weather on Portable Generator Performance

Cold weather can certainly alter the total effect of how well a portable generator may perform, the main reason being that it has an influencing effect on both mechanical operations and fuel efficiency of the generator. When the temperature levels are scaled down, more so it becomes even colder, the engine oil is likely to become viscous, lessening the efficiency of lubrication thereby causing more wear and tear on the components which can make starting the engine hard. On the other hand, it is very common to have the carburetor on a generator in such conditions become iced, as the ice that is being accumulated causes the airflow to be blocked and this creates interruptions in the air-fuel mixture thus resulting into diminishing performance or failure to start the engine.

Winter conditions greatly impair the fuel efficiency and storage of the device. Diesel generators in particular face significant problems because surplus fuel coagulates in the pipelines under the extreme weather conditions and is difficult to flow. The situation even worsens when such diesel generators are left without any fuel treatment for a long time. Moreover, the rise and fall of temperatures inside the fuel tank may result in water contamination and this could in turn cause rust, blocked fuel filters or malfunctions. Many efforts need to be made for a smooth operation of the equipment in cold likely. These measures include the use of oil from winter season, incorporation of respective fuel conditioners or antifreeze in the fuel, as appropriate packaging operations procedures including fuel protection, amongst others.

Common Generator Issues in Winter Months

Issue

Description

Solution

Difficulty Starting

Battery weakened by cold temperatures

Use a battery warmer or keep indoors

Fuel Line Freeze

Moisture in fuel lines freezes, blocking fuel flow

Add fuel stabilizer or antifreeze additives

Oil Thickening

Low temperatures cause oil to thicken

Use winter-grade or synthetic oil

Moisture Accumulation

Condensation leads to generator corrosion

Conduct regular inspections and store properly

Carburetor Issues

Stale fuel clogs carburetor components

Empty fuel or use fresh stabilized fuel

Voltage Fluctuations

Low temperature affects generator’s electrical output

Use a voltage regulator or check wiring systems

Exhaust Blockage

Snow or ice blocks exhaust vents

Clear snow and ice around the generator

Spark Plug Failure

Spark plugs degrade, reducing ignition reliability

Inspect and replace spark plugs periodically

Overloading

Excess power demand strains the generator’s components

Ensure usage within rated capacity of the unit

Air Filter Clogging

Freezing of moisture or debris clogging the filter

Clean or replace air filter monthly

Battery Maintenance for Winter

Winter is the most delicate period, and a lot can be done to maintain the battery of the portable generator. First, examine the battery connections for signs of buildup which can be easily removed using an underflow covering a base of baking soda and water and scrubbed around with a brush. Next, make sure there are no loose connections after cleaning to eliminate the need of fixed voltage. Before troubleshooting, the battery’s voltage should be checked by a multimeter. An average portable generator battery running cost at a fully charged state is around 12.6 to 12.8 volts.

In case the battery voltage fails to meet the recommended value, it is advisable to use an automatic battery charger other known as a trickle or float charger to top off and maintain its correct charge volume. In case the generators are of the type that use lithium ion batteries, they require specially calibrated chargers to prevent any damage. Moreover, for safekeeping when the period of inactivity is too long, the battery should be isolated and placed in a cool and dry area to reduce the chances of any self discharge. Compared to quite a number of batteries, a test on the load size of the battery will show the degree of charge among the lithium-ion batteries in use. Besides any of the above-mentioned steps, the recommended and recognized method of failure is adopted by always monitoring the portable generator’s battery especially in cold conditions where the demand for starting is high.
